This transmute cannot be trained, instead it is rewarded by the quest Cardinal Ruby, which is available from the Dalaran alchemy trainer Linzy Blackbolt for all alchemist that have an Alchemy skill of 450 . The quest requires you to perform 5 of any epic gem transmutes, effectively giving other sources of epic gems a 5 day head start on Cardinal Ruby creation.

Tooltip
Transmute the element of fire and a Scarlet Ruby into a Cardinal Ruby.

The following gems can be transmuted by an Alchemist without a cooldown. The link is to a blue post confirming what Alchemists on the PTR are experiencing. I have xmuted dozens in a row and the lack of CD is not a bug. So, expect the epic gems to come more into a reasonable line as far as prices go after a few weeks of the patch.(6/30/09) Build 10048: The 20 hour CD has been placed on epic xmutes and significant changes have been made to the materials required. The information below has been updated as of the stated build.
(8/6/08) Live Patch 3.2.0: Changed the Eye of Zul requirements to reflect the state which the patch was taken live.
Transmutable gems in 3.2.0 and the required materials:
- Cardinal Ruby: 1 Scarlet Ruby and 1 Eternal Fire instead of 3 Eye of Zul
- Majestic Zircon: 1 Sky Sapphire and 1 Eternal Air instead of 3 Sky Sapphire
- King's Amber: 1 Autumn's Glow and 1 Eternal Life instead of 1 Majestic Zircon and 2 Eternal Life
- Dreadstone: 1 Twilight Opal and 1 Eternal Shadow instead of 3 Twilight Opal
- Eye of Zul:3 Forest Emerald
- Ametrine: 1 Monarch Topaz and 1 Eternal Shadow instead of 1 Majestic Zircon and 2 Eternal Shadow

As of patch 4.0.1, the cooldown for epic gem transmutes resets at midnight, server time, regardless of when you perform the spell. This effectively makes the CD a static 24 hours, but allows you to perform it anytime during your day.

It is one cooldown for all the gem transmutes, as previously stated. So, if you wanted to transmute an ametrine after your cardinal ruby, you would have to wait 20 hours.

As of todays new 3.2 PTR build...
- Epic Gems transmutations now have a 20 hours cooldown.
- Transmute: Ametrine now requires 1 x Monarch Topaz and 1 x Eternal Shadow
- Transmute: Cardinal Ruby now requires 1 x Scarlet Ruby and 1 x Eternal Fire
- Transmute: Dreadstone now requires 1 x Twilight Opal and 1 x Eternal Shadow
- Transmute: Eye of Zul now requires 3 x Eternal Life
- Transmute: King's Amber now requires 1 x Autumn's Glow and 1 x Eternal Life
- Transmute: Majestic Zircon now requires 1 x Eternal Air and 1 x Eternal Air
